Effect of Exercise Intensity on Exogenous Glucose Requirements to Maintain Stable Glycemia At High Insulin Levels in Type 1 Diabetes.
Shetty, Vinutha B; Fournier, Paul A; Paramalingam, Nirubasini; Soon, Wayne; Roby, Heather C; Jones, Timothy W; Davis, Elizabeth A.
